Collaboration Allows Seriously Ill Patients to Remain Close to Home for Transplant Evaluation

 

NEW YORK (June 13, 2016) – Montefiore Health System has a new collaborative program with its partner St. John’s Riverside Hospital to offer patients suffering from kidney, pancreas or liver disease an opportunity to be evaluated for transplantation at St. John’s Riverside Hospital by specialists from Montefiore Einstein Center for Transplantation. The collaboration is designed to increase continuity of care for patients and their families with their local healthcare providers and transplant experts in an easy, accessible manner.

“Earlier evaluation of patients suffering from kidney, pancreases and liver disease can help identify potential barriers to being placed on transplant lists and determine if alternative medical or surgical therapies would be most appropriate,” said Milan Kinkhabwala, M.D., chief of the Division of Transplantation and director of abdominal transplantation at the Montefiore Einstein Center for Transplantation, and professor of surgery at Albert Einstein College of Medicine. “We encourage transplant candidates to take advantage of these consultations as they can help ensure comprehensive care is initiated in a timely fashion. It will also allow us to identify how to best keep patients as healthy as possible and improve their quality of life while they await a transplant.”

Montefiore Einstein Center for Transplantation reports that Montefiore adult patient survival rates consistently rank higher than the national average, with a 95.09 percent liver transplant one-year survival rate vs. a 90.89 percent national liver transplant one-year survival rate, according to the Centers for Medicaid and Medicare Services.

“St. John’s Riverside Hospital is excited to partner with Montefiore in this collaborative transplant program,” said Paul P Antonecchia, M.D., chief medical officer, St. John’s Riverside Hospital. “As we seek to provide expanded healthcare services to our community, this type of collaboration will positively impact the level of care that we can provide closer to our patients’ homes.”
